Abstract:
omega Centauri is the most well studied Galactic Globular Cluster
because of its numerous puzzling features: significant dispersion in
metallicity, multiple populations, triple main-sequence, horizontal
branch morphology, He-rich population(s), and extended star-formation
history. Intensive spectroscopic follow-up observing campaigns
targeting stars at different positions in the color-magnitude
diagram promises to clarify some of these peculiarities.
To be able to target cluster members reliably during spectroscopic
surveys and both spatial and radial distributions in the cluster
outskirts without including field stars, a high quality proper-motion
catalog of omega Cen and membership probability determination are
required. The only available wide field proper-motion catalog of omega
Cen is derived from photographic plates, and only for stars brighter
than B∼16. Using ESO archive data, we create a new, CCD-based,
proper-motion catalog for this cluster, extending to B∼20.
We used high precision astrometric software developed specifically for
data acquired by WFI@2.2m telescope and presented in the first paper
of this series.
Description:
Wide-field (∼33'x33') proper motion catalog for nearly 360000 stars
centered around Omega Cen center. Calibrated and sky concentration
corrected UBVRCIC wide-band photometry plus a narrow-band filter
centered on Halpha. Membership probability determination with two
different, complementary methods.
